Fifteen‑year‑old Sooryavanshi Tears Apart Chennai with 15‑ball Fifty in IPL
Rajasthan Royals bowled out Chennai Super Kings for 127 and chased the target in 12.1 overs with a 15-ball fifty by Vaibhav Suryavanshi, dominating the IPL 2026 opener.
- On Monday, Rajasthan Royals defeated Chennai Super Kings by eight wickets in the IPL 2026 opener at Guwahati. The Royals chased the 127-run target in 12.1 overs, securing a dominant win and major net run rate boost.
- Royals bowlers dismantled CSK for 127 in 19.4 overs after Captain Riyan Parag won the toss and chose to bowl. The visitors collapsed during a disastrous powerplay, slipping to 41/4 and never recovering momentum.
- Teen sensation Vaibhav Sooryavanshi starred on debut, racing to a half-century in 15 balls with five fours and five sixes. Yashasvi Jaiswal anchored the chase unbeaten on 38, while Shimron Hetmyer finished with 18 off nine balls.
- Returning to Rajasthan Royals, Ravindra Jadeja claimed two wickets alongside Jofra Archer and Nandre Burger, each taking two. Every bowler contributed as CSK never recovered despite Jamie Overton's resilient 43.
- Sanju Samson failed on his CSK debut, dismissed for six by Nandre Burger. Both teams, bottom-placed last season, traded Samson and Jadeja ahead of this IPL campaign to reshape their rosters.
